Transaction 263df705cc30a5ecfbaab597d7409701cacaab8f3d5161872419be279551e686

1 Input
2 Outputs
  • 263df705cc30a5ecfbaab597d7409701cacaab8f3d5161872419be279551e686:0
  • value  1100000
    address  32aB4URgCBotgQ8TeJupeUHiQhbtJqvhjN
  • 263df705cc30a5ecfbaab597d7409701cacaab8f3d5161872419be279551e686:1
  • value  2881468
    address  1FaqLFTntkicc9n8GsSE71YhiBHFiuhQC4